Sold Mine

I just wanted to thank everyone for their good advice on my last thread about selling my RDX/ tech. It had 3,600 miles on it and I sold it at Carmax for 31.5k . I was pleased to get such a good offer. I was offered 28.5k as a trade in at the VW dealership (i'm getting a Passat) which I thought was insulting, but I wasn't really surprised. They actually called the Acura deealership (because they would have traded it to them) who told them they had several RDXs going to auction and could not do any better. Carmax was a great idea and I thank the person who suggested it.
